Brown Recluse Removal & Extermination

In most cases, the Brown Recluse you’ll find in Huntington, TX isn’t very large. On average, the brown recluse measures between 0.5 to 1 inch in size. It can be identified by its characteristic brown color and the black line running down its back. Many describe that this stripe resembles the shape of a fiddle, which is why the brown recluse is often called the fiddleback spider.
